The Effect Of Intermittent Fasting Combined With Aerobic Endurance Exercise On The Immune Function Of Rats

Intermittent fasting is an effective means of preventing and curing chronic diseases in fasting therapy.In addition to reducing body weight by reducing caloric intake,it can also change energy metabolism patterns,change intestinal flora,induce autophagy and adjust the "biological clock." And other ways to prevent the occurrence of chronic metabolic diseases.In animal models such as rodents and monkeys,intermittent fasting has been shown to extend life span and reduce inflammation and cancer.Exercise has always been considered by people as an effective means to promote physical health.Studies have shown that long-term adherence to moderate-intensity aerobic endurance exercise can increase the activation level of immune cells or factors such as immune globulin,lymphocytes,and interleukins in the body,promote the improvement of the body’s immune function,and reduce the occurrence of inflammatory symptoms such as diseases.In this experiment,intermittent fasting,aerobic endurance exercise and the combination of the two experimental interventions were conducted in rats to compare the differences in the levels of interleukin(IL-1,IL-2,IL-6)and immunoglobulin(IgA,IgM,IgG)in rats after the experiment due to different interventions,and further explore The effect of intermittent fasting combined with aerobic endurance exercise on the immune function of rats.Method: This study intervened 8 week experimentally,selected 26 eligible SD rats,and randomly divided them into 4 groups,each with 6-7 animals in cages and divided into a quiet control group(Control,Con N=6);fasting Group(Intermittent Fasting,IF N=6);exercise group(Exercise,Ex N=7);fasting exercise group(Intermittent Fasting Exercise,IFEx N=7).This experiment adopts an intermittent fasting plan every Wednesday and Saturday.Drinking water is unlimited during the fasting period,and you can eat and drink freely during the time outside the fasting.In this experiment,the aerobic endurance exercise program is carried out for four days per week,1,2,4,and 5,with an intensity of 65% VO2 max,aerobic endurance exercise training,the treadmill is set at 20m/min,0° slope,and the duration of each exercise 60 min,the first week of aerobic endurance exercise intervention is exercise adaptation training.The weight of the rats was recorded at the same time every day.After the experiment,the blood of the rat was centrifuged to take the supernatant,and the levels of interleukin(IL-1,IL-2,IL-6)and immunoglobulin(IgA,IgM,IgG)in the rat plasma were detected by Western Blot and ELISA experimental methods according to the standard.Result:1.After the experiment,the weight of rats in the IF group and IFEx group was compared with the weight of the Con group,and the results were highly significant(P<0.01).There was a significant difference in the weight of the Ex group and the CON group(P<0.05).);Experiments show that the weight gain of the IFEx group was the slowest.2.Under the intervention of intermittent fasting,the level of IL-1 in the plasma of rats increased significantly(P<0.01),and the levels of IL-2 and IL-6 did not change significantly(P>0.05);aerobic endurance exercise intervention The levels of IL-1,IL-2,and IL-6 in the plasma of rats were significantly increased(P<0.01);the combined intervention of the two resulted in the levels of IL-1,IL-2,and IL-6 in the plasma of rats.Very significant increase(P<0.01);after experimental intervention,the IL-1 level of each group were ranked as IF>IFEx>Ex>CON;after the experimental intervention,the IL-2 level of each group were ranked as IFEx>Ex>CON>IF;experimental intervention The IL-6 levels of each group were ranked as Ex>IFEx>CON>IF.3.The levels of IgA,IgM,and IgG in the rat plasma under the intervention of intermittent fasting decreased,and IgA decreased significantly(P<0.01);IgG decreased significantly(P<0.05);aerobic endurance exercise intervention The levels of IgA,IgM,and IgG in the plasma of rats were significantly increased(P<0.01);the combined intervention of the two increased the levels of IgM in the plasma of rats significantly(P<0.01),There were no significant changes in IgA and IgM(P>0.05).The content of immunoglobulin in rat plasma is IgG>IgA>IgM.Conclusion:1.Intermittent fasting for two days a week makes the rat immune cells lack the energy for re-synthesis,and the improvement of rat immune function is not obvious.The occurrence of rat immune function suppression is observed.Therefore,it is recommended to adopt appropriate dietary restrictions instead of fasting,which will have a good effect on immune function.2.Aerobic endurance exercise can effectively activate the rat’s immune system,enhance the intercellular transfer material interleukin(IL-1,IL-2,IL-6)and immunoglobulin(IgA,IgM,IgG)secreted by rat immune cells,and promote the improvement of rat immune function.3.The joint intervention of intermittent fasting and aerobic endurance exercise can promote the immune function of rats and enhance the immune function of rats.Since intermittent fasting has been observed to inhibit the occurrence,it is recommended to take an appropriate amount of food restriction intervention and appropriate exercise intervention,which is more beneficial to promote health.
